It is a software that is based on a set of statements and protocols with an intent to integrate systems and facilitate interaction between software apps by following a series of rules.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The tool enables developers to access and use the existing infrastructure which further makes it possible to interlink two applications. Moreover, an API trades data between various software to automate procedures and build new features in a website or application.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<h2><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"How-does-an-API-work\"><\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">How does an API work?<\/span><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">As mentioned already, the application programming interface works as a bridge between kinds of web or apps and can be built in different programming languages. Apart from being properly developed, an API much have clear and objective documentation to ease implementation.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">APIs are also often used in a predefined data format to share insights between systems to achieve integration between them.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Look below to find the most used ones:<\/span><\/p>\n<ul>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">XML (extension markup language)<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">YAML (originally YET another markup language)\u00a0<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">JSON ( JavaScript Object Notation)<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">There\u2019s also a standard for web APIs called REST (representational state transfer) which is a set of rules and definitions for building projects with enticing and well-driven interfaces.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<h2><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"What-kinds-of-APIs-are-there\"><\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">What kinds of APIs are there?<\/span><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">There are three types of APIs when it comes to shared use policies. Let\u2019s discuss that below.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<h3><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"API-by-use-policy\"><\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">API by use policy:<\/span><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h3>\n<h4><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"1-Public-or-open-APIs\"><\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">1. Public or open APIs<\/span><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h4>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Public or open APIs are available for other users or <\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/dianapps.com\/hire-developer\"><b>Hire developers<\/b><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> to use with minimal restrictions or, in some cases, are fully accessible.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<h4><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"2-Private-or-internal-APIs\"><\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">2. Private or internal APIs<\/span><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h4>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Private or internal Private or internal APIS are only accessible by a company&#8217;s internal system and are concealed from outside users. They are utilized for the internal growth of the business, maximizing efficiency and service reuse.<\/span><\/p>\n<h4><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"3-Partner-APIs\"><\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">3. Partner APIs\u00a0<\/span><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h4>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Shared APIs within business relationships are known as partner APIs. They need specific permission to use them because they aren&#8217;t accessible to everyone.<\/span><\/p>\n<h4><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"4-Composite-APIs\"><\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">4. Composite APIs<\/span><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h4>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Composite APIs make use of various data or many service APIs and provide developers access to several endpoints.<\/span><\/p>\n<h3><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"API-by-use-case\"><\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">API by use case<\/span><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h3>\n<h4><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"1-Data-APIs\"><\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">1. Data APIs\u00a0<\/span><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h4>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Data APIs facilitate communication between apps and database management systems by giving various SaaS (Software as a Service) databases and providers CRUD (Create, Read, Update, Delete) access to underlying data sets.<\/span><\/p>\n<h4><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"2-Operating-system-APIs\"><\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">2. Operating system APIs<\/span><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h4>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">This set of APIs governs the utilization of resources and operating system features by applications. Each OS has its own set of APIs; for instance, the kernel-user space API and kernel internal API in Linux and Windows, respectively.<\/span><\/p>\n<h4><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"3-Remote-APIs\"><\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">3. Remote APIs<\/span><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h4>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">This group specifies the expectations for app interaction across various platforms. In other words, contrary to what the term implies, the software accesses resources that are not on the device making the request. Remote APIs employ protocols to create connections between two apps that are connected remotely over a network.<\/span><\/p>\n<h4><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"4-Web-APIs\"><\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">4. Web APIs\u00a0<\/span><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h4>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Web APIs provide data that devices may read and transmit between web-based systems or a customer-server architecture, making this type of API the most popular.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><img decoding=\"async\" class=\"wp-image-5441 aligncenter\" src=\"https:\/\/dianapps.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/01\/1_5_VEtMBQg9h-WossdhK3Ow.png\" alt=\"\" width=\"915\" height=\"515\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.dianapps.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/01\/1_5_VEtMBQg9h-WossdhK3Ow-768x432.png 768w, https:\/\/www.dianapps.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/01\/1_5_VEtMBQg9h-WossdhK3Ow-640x360.png 640w, https:\/\/www.dianapps.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/01\/1_5_VEtMBQg9h-WossdhK3Ow-400x225.png 400w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 915px) 100vw, 915px\" \/><\/p>\n<h3><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"API-Protocols\"><\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">API Protocols\u00a0<\/span><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h3>\n<h4><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"1-Remote-Procedure-Call-RPC\"><\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">1. Remote Procedure Call (RPC)<\/span><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h4>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Web APIs can adhere to resource exchange norms thanks to RPC. With the help of a program that asks for data (the customer) and another that provides it remotely, this protocol seeks to specify how applications communicate (server).<\/span><\/p>\n<h4><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"2-Service-Object-Access-Protocol-SOAP\"><\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">2. Service Object Access Protocol (SOAP)<\/span><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h4>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">This is a simple protocol for transferring structured data in a distributed, decentralized setting. For requests and answers that are sent by applications, their specifications provide syntactic guidelines.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Applications that comply with these requirements can communicate with the system via SMTP or HTTP (Hypertext Transfer Protocol) (Simple Mail Transfer Protocol).<\/span><\/p>\n<h4><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"3-Representational-state-transfer-REST\"><\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">3. Representational state transfer (REST)<\/span><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h4>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">REST is an architectural software style that imposes six constraints on the development of programs that use HTTP, particularly online services.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Since many developers find SOAP cumbersome to use since they must write a lot of code to perform a task, it is seen as an alternative to SOAP. REST, on the other hand, adheres to a distinct logic that makes it simpler to access data and resources.<\/span><\/p>\n<h4><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"4-GraphQL\"><\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">4. GraphQL<\/span><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h4>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The necessity for quicker feature development, a more effective data load, and more mobile flexibility led to the creation of GraphQL.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Customers may provide specifics about the data they require using this API query language, which also makes it easier to add information from other sources.<\/span><\/p>\n<h2><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"What-are-the-advantages-of-API\"><\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">What are the advantages of API?<\/span><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Source: <a href=\"https:\/\/www.quora.com\/What-are-the-advantages-of-API\">https:\/\/www.quora.com\/What-are-the-advantages-of-API<\/a><\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Knowing the advantages of API development enables you to work with system owners and other stakeholders to update the agency&#8217;s systems and realize their enormous potential. Weather Snippets\u00a0<\/span><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h3>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The most prevalent example of daily weather data utilization for APIs is. On all platforms, including Google Search, Apple&#8217;s Weather, and even your smartphone, rich weather summaries are prevalent.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">For instance, if you type &#8220;weather + [your location&#8217;s name]&#8221; into Google, a dedicated box containing the current weather and prediction will appear at the top of your search results. This box is referred to as a &#8220;rich snippet.&#8221;<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Since Google does not currently provide meteorological data, they obtain it from a third party. Google uses APIs to receive the most recent meteorological data and quickly format it.<\/span><\/p>\n<h3><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"2-Log-in-Using-XYZ\"><\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">2.
